- Short documentary about the mass deaths of mainly native children in Papua New Guinea due to a stomach disease or enteritis commonly known as Pigbel or Pikbel. Documents the discovery, cause, medical research, treatment, and control of the disease as well as the vaccination and immunization of PNG's indigenous people from it. Filmed in Goroka, at Goroka Hospital, and in the Papua New Guinean highlands and villages.
